Architecture#
- Domain-Driven Design:
internal/domain/<name>/holds business logic, types, sentinel errors, interfaces. Current domains:apikey,auth,content,customfield,dashboard,media,plugin,posttype,profilepicture,sanitize,seo,textgen,thumbnail,user - Repository pattern: interfaces in domain, per-driver implementations in
internal/repository/{sqlite,mysql,postgresql}/. Shared cross-driver helpers (e.g.,soft_delete.go,user.go) live directly ininternal/repository/ - HTTP handlers:
internal/api/handlers/(browser admin realm) andinternal/api/handlers/agent/(Bearer API-key realm,/api/v1); routes registered ininternal/api/routes/routes.go - Auth realms: two co-exist on shared paths and are dispatched by
dispatchByAuth()based on theAuthorizationheader prefix (Bearer lesstruct_…= agent realm, JWT cookie or other Bearer = browser realm). Each chain carries its own auth middleware - Middleware (
internal/api/middleware/):auth(JWT),apikey(Bearer API key),admin,commentator,cors,csrf,nocookie,ratelimit(via httprate) - Response envelope (
internal/api/response/):{"data": ..., "error": {...}, "meta": {...}}. Lists useSuccessList()which uses a dedicatedlistResponsetype WITHOUTomitemptyondataso empty lists serialize as"data":[] - Plugin system: wazero WASM runtime in
internal/plugin/with hook execution (before_save,after_save, etc.). Subpackages:bootstrap,capability,devmode,hostfunctions,loader,registry,runtime - Content pipeline:
internal/content/holds format converters —tiptap/(canonical),markdown/(Markdown→TipTap via goldmark),wordpress/(WordPress importer). Content items carry aformatfield (tiptap,html, ormarkdown). HTML-format content is stored and served as-is — no TipTap conversion. The WXR importer accepts any post type registered inconfig.toml(built-inpost/pageplus custom types), parses<wp:postmeta>custom fields, and converts values to the declared field types (e.g. WordPressYYYY-MM-DD HH:MM:SSdatetimes → RFC 3339; numeric strings →float64) before passing them to the content service asCustomFields. Featured images (_thumbnail_id) are resolved from attachment items, downloaded via the media downloader (WebP transcode + SHA-256 dedup), and prepended to the post’s TipTap content; inline body images are likewise downloaded and remapped. Attachment items themselves are captured as a lookup table (post ID → URL) inWXRDocument.Attachmentsbut never become content posts. - Content sanitization: HTML content (format
html) is sanitized on write (both browser and agent API handlers runSanitizeHTMLDocumentbefore persisting) and on read (the public contentpage handler re-sanitizes before rendering). The policy (internal/domain/sanitize/htmldocument.go) allows all HTML5 elements and inlinestyle/classattributes while blocking<script>, event handlers (on*), andjavascript:URLs. TipTap content is sanitized differently — raw HTML within TipTap bodies is stripped to plain text via bluemonday’sUGCPolicy. AI-generated HTML is also sanitized server-side incallChatCompletionHTML(ininternal/domain/textgen/service.go) before being returned to the client. - AI text generation:
internal/domain/textgen/provides theTextGenerationServiceinterface withEnhanceTextandTranslateTextmethods, both parameterized by aformatfield (tiptaporhtml). For HTML format, the service is constructed with the active theme’s minifiedbase.css(design tokens) andstyle.css(component styles), read once at startup bytemplate.ReadThemeStyles(internal/api/template/template.go) and baked into the system prompt so generated HTML reuses the site’s CSS custom properties (var(--color-primary),var(--space-*), etc.) and component classes (.btn,.container,.form-control) instead of inventing off-brand styles. The handler also injects a keyword-filtered subset of the user’s media library (up to 20 images, matched by alt-text overlap with the user’s prompt) as context in the user prompt. The HTML system prompt instructs the AI to produce production-ready fragments with<style>blocks at the top, scoped class names (.ls-<topic>), responsive CSS, and accessible semantic HTML5. The handler (internal/api/handlers/textgen.go) owns theMediaListerinterface and thebuildMediaContexthelper (textgen_media.go). - Config:
.env+ env vars loaded viainternal/config/config.go(Configstruct,Load()); user-facingconfig.tomlin project root loaded once at startup from${CONFIG_DIR}/${CONFIG_FILE}(no hot-reload — restart the server to pick up changes); post types/languages/thumbnails/CSP schemas ininternal/config/ - Migrations: numbered
.up.sql/.down.sqlpairs ininternal/database/migrations/{driver}/, embedded viaembed.go
Request flow & auth realms#
Two auth realms co-exist on shared paths. dispatchByAuth() inspects the Authorization header prefix to route each request through one chain before it reaches a handler — downstream code is auth-agnostic because both inject the same context keys (UserIDKey, UsernameKey, RoleKey).

Critical Implementation Rules#
Language-Specific Rules#
Go#
- Use
any, neverinterface{} - Never use
panic()— uselog.Fatalf()/log.Panicf()only inmain.go(and only incmd/lesstruct-cli/main.gofor the CLI) - Private structs/functions before public ones in every file
- Constructors (
New*) go AFTER all methods on the struct - Multi-line function arguments when ≥3 params (one arg per line)
- Always use constants for HTTP methods:
http.MethodDelete, not"DELETE" internal/config/holds env-based config;config.tomlholds user-facing config- Domain errors are sentinel errors (
var ErrSomething = errors.New(...)) in the domain package; when propagating, wrap withfmt.Errorf("failed to X: %w", err)soerrors.Is/errors.Aschains stay intact - Handlers map domain errors to HTTP responses via a
switchovererrors.Is. Two error-code casings exist — match the realm you are in: the agent API (/api/v1,internal/api/handlers/agent/errors.go) emitsUPPER_SNAKEcodes (NOT_FOUND,FORBIDDEN,VALIDATION_ERROR,INTERNAL_ERROR); the browser/admin API (internal/api/handlers/, per-resourcehandleXxxError()) emitslowercase_snakecodes (content_not_found,invalid_title). When you add a new domain sentinel, register it in BOTH mappers - JSON responses use the envelope from
internal/api/response/— callSuccess,Error, orSuccessList; never hand-roll the envelope - Logging uses the injected
util.Logger, which is printf-style:h.logger.Error("failed to X: %v", err). Never usefmt.Printlnorlog.*outsidemain.go - Cross-driver repository code must work for SQLite, PostgreSQL, AND MySQL — beware driver-specific SQL (placeholders,
RETURNING, time handling). Use the per-driver subpackage when behavior must diverge

Framework-Specific Rules#
Backend (Chi + Domain-Driven Design)#
- No framework: Chi is a lightweight router, not a framework — handlers receive
http.ResponseWriter, *http.Request - Routes registered in
internal/api/routes/routes.go, grouped by resource and by auth realm - Two auth realms co-own some
/api/v1/mediapaths — when adding routes that may collide, register viadispatchByAuth(agentChain, browserChain)rather than duplicating the path - Agent realm (
/api/v1/*) requires Bearerlesstruct_<keyID>_<secret>tokens verified byAPIKeyAuthMiddleware; identity is injected into context using the SAME context keys (UserIDKey,UsernameKey,RoleKey) as the JWT middleware so downstream code is auth-agnostic - Content services require a
HookExecutor— always pass plugin hooks through, don’t bypass - Custom field validation flows through
content.Service.validateCustomFields()— never callvalidateFieldValue()directly from handlers - Post types loaded from
config.tomlonce at startup viainternal/config/posttypes.go(restart to pick up changes); built-in slugs (post/page/media/comment) extend instead of duplicating - Homepage sections (
[[homepage_section]]), public listing page size (POSTS_PER_PAGEenv), site-wide identity ([site_config]→name/logo), and the public custom-field query allowlist ([[public_field]]) are loaded the same way —internal/config/homepage.go,siteconfig.go, andpublicfield.go; the site name defaults toLesstructin the contentpage handler constructor and drivesPageTitlesuffixes +og:site_name(the one branding value aTHEME_DIRoverride cannot reach). Public listing queries (GetPublishedByPostType/GetPublishedByAuthorUsername/GetPublishedByTag) take an optionallanguageargument so the primary-language scope and the pagination HasNext probe happen at the SQL level, not in Go. Public custom-field filter/sort on/api/v1/public/{content_items,authors}is gated byPublicFieldRegistry.IsQueryable— without an entry, the request fails closed with400 field_not_queryable. Public field values can also be opted into the response body via the"expose"operation (PublicFieldRegistry.ExposedFields), projected at the handler level and rendered on both JSON and HTML author pages. - SEO auto-extraction:
ExtractPlainText()andExtractImageURL()consume TipTap JSON from content; HTML content uses tag-stripping for meta description extraction - Markdown bodies on the agent create surface are converted to canonical TipTap JSON via
internal/content/markdown— raw Markdown is NEVER persisted; HTML bodies (format: html) are stored as-is after sanitization - Slug is immutable: on create, any authenticated user may supply
CreateContentRequest.Slug(validated byValidateSlug, uniqueness checked per language viaRepository.CheckSlugUnique); if omitted the service auto-generates from the title (Service.GenerateSlug). On update the slug never changes — the title-change→regenerate path was removed so the public URL stays stable for SEO. The CLI exposes it vialesstruct-cli content create --slug. - Rate limits configurable per realm via
RATE_LIMIT_{AUTH,API,PUBLIC}_PER_MINUTE; toggle viaRATE_LIMIT_ENABLED
